    Looks like you are using the direct wireless feature of your printer that allows your printer generate its own wifi signal and your laptop / PC connect directly to-cela the drawback being that it puts the signal from your laptop / PC to the printer and prevents internet access.

    The best way to print wireless while being able to use internet on your device is to connect your printer and your laptop / PC to your home wifi signal. You must disable all direct features active wireless on your printer off and connect to your wifi signal at home (not the 85 HP Envy 4520 series Direct signal).

    Hi lionness91,

    White pages or impressions of light can be caused by any of the following reasons:

    • Ink cartridges are not installed.
    • Ink depleted.
    • Failure of the print head.

    Here are some steps we can try in this case:

    1. Reinstall the ink cartridges. If the cartridges do not seem to fit, make sure that the print head is installed and re - install the cartridges again.
    2. Try using a spare cartridges to reproduce the problem. We would be able to locate it to a cartridge impoverished if the replacement cartridge helps you to print correctly.
    3. Load plain paper.
    4. In the printer control panel, press menu .
    5. Press the arrow keys to scroll to maintenance, and press OK.
    6. Press the arrows to scroll to print head deep cleaning, then press on OK. Print a cleaning page.
    7. Press the arrow keys to scroll to align printerand press OK. Print an alignment page.

      Note:
      does not remove the alignment page until printing is complete.
    8. Select a higher print quality in the printer software. To select a better print quality:
      1. Your document open, click file print.
      2. The print dialog box opens.
      3. Click Preferences, Properties, Options, or Setup (depending on the program or operating system).
      4. The Print Options dialog box opens.
      5. On the Print Setup tab, select a higher quality setting.
      6. Reprint the document.
    9. Make sure that the Firmware is updated to the latest version from the link: http://dell.to/13SF1D7
      1. Make sure that you have selected the right operating system before you start to download the firmware.
      2. Print head needs to be removed and the cover must be closed before you upgrade the firmware.
      3. After the update of the firmware, install the print head and try to print.
    10. If the steps above do not resolve the problem, you can consider replacing the print head service kit.
